Wanted Mexican food for lunch and stumbled across this place in one of my preferred food plazas in Duluth. I was glad to see that had a selection of beers and drinks available. I ordered the carne asada tacos and what stood out to me was the handmade tortillas for the tacos. The steak was loaded on there generously and their green salsa paired with it perfectly. I really enjoyed eating them, this place did give off an authentic feeling. Staff is nice and do speak Spanish primarily. Food comes out quickly on a steady day. I will have to come back again for lunch.

This place is by far the best AUTHENTIC Hispanic food place to eat in all of GA! I can’t begin to tell you how much I enjoy eating here. The food is always consistent as you can see by the photos. I’ve been hooked since day one when I bit into a chorizo taco! The tortillas are unique in corn and the portion sizes are just right, not to much and not to little. The rice and beans seemed to be cooked fresh daily! The nachos are now my favorite. The chips come out crunchy and not stale or soggy. The cheese is queso but the cheese does not make the plate a soupy dish but is truly a topping. The steak is beautifully cooked and the fresh Avocado makes the cherry on top. If I could give this restaurant a ten stars I would!
